Output 216d22a8f98761633d757bfbd0ebc4f1974ec9161248c827bdce3385197787f8:29

value
648484
script pubkey
OP_HASH160 OP_PUSHBYTES_20 534b0cabce26fbc9694a64d4c79c9bc7606c70e0 OP_EQUAL
address
39HRuzjBg4BHmdu24JHZQHXCicNxVxfJQn
transaction
216d22a8f98761633d757bfbd0ebc4f1974ec9161248c827bdce3385197787f8
spent
true